dc.description.abstract | A novel home-made hybrid detection system was designed for simultaneous determination of caffeine (CAF), dipyrone (DIP) and ergotamine (ERG) in pharmaceutical preparations. Thus, ERG was determined by a fluorimetric signal and PLS-1 method for resolving DIP and CAF UV-V spectral data was used. The calibration curve for ERG was linear over the range 2.5 - 10 mg L-1. The calibration set consisted of 18 mixtures with 0.5 to 4 mg L-1 for CAF, 5 to 20 mg L-1 for DIP and 2.5 and 10 mg L-1 for ERG. Sample preparation prior to analysis was not required. A recovery study with the real samples was carried out and the obtained results were highly satisfactory. | |
dc.description.abstract | Um novo sistema híbrido para detecção simultânea de cafeína (CAF), dipirona (DIP) e de ergotamina (ERG) foi desenvolvido para teste de preparações farmaceuticas. ERG foi determinada por um sinal fluorimétrico, enquanto para CAF e DIP foi utilizado o método PLS-1 para resolução de dados espectrométricos de UV-Vis. A curva de calibração da ERG foi linear na faixa de 2.5 10 mg L-1. O conjunto de calibrações constiui-se de 18 soluções com 0.5 a 4 mg L-1de CAF, 5 a 20 mg L-1 de DIP e de 2.5 e 10 mg L-1 de ERG. Não foi necessária a prepração de amostras anterior à análise. Foram realizados estudos de recuperação com amostras reais obtendo-se resultados altamente satisfatórios | |
